Euronext registers 5.8% Y/Y increase in FX trading revenue in Q1 2026
FX Trading Revenue
€9.8 million
Euronext's FX trading revenue for Q1 2026, reflecting a 5.8% increase year-over-year.
Consolidated Revenue
€528.5 million
Total consolidated revenue for Euronext in Q1 2026, up 15.3% year-over-year.
Adjusted EBITDA
€343.2 million
Adjusted EBITDA for Q1 2026, marking a 16.7% increase compared to Q1 2025.
⦿ Executive Snapshot
- What: Euronext recorded a 5.8% year-over-year increase in FX trading revenue for Q1 2026.
- Who: Euronext, a European capital market infrastructure provider.
- Why it matters: The growth in FX trading revenue reflects a dynamic trading environment and solid organic growth, highlighting the resilience of non-volume related revenue in a volatile market.
⦿ Key Developments
- Euronext's FX trading revenue in Q1 2026 was €9.8 million, a 5.8% increase compared to Q1 2025, driven by record volumes and market volatility.
- Consolidated revenue and income for Euronext in Q1 2026 reached €528.5 million, up 15.3% year-over-year, attributed to strong growth across all segments and contributions from acquisitions.
- Adjusted EBITDA for Q1 2026 was €343.2 million, marking a 16.7% increase compared to Q1 2025, with an EBITDA margin of 64.9%.
